Castleman Disease Education Portal
Developed by Dr. Robert Ohgami and the ARUP team, this website provides education on Castleman disease subtypes—covering diagnostic clues, histopathology, and the role of excisional biopsy. It features expert videos, case examples, and diagnostic criteria to support timely, accurate identification of idiopathic multicentric Castleman disease (iMCD).

International Diagnostic Criteria
International, evidence-based consensus diagnostic criteria for diagnosing HHV-8 negative idiopathic multicentric Castleman disease (iMCD) were published in 2017.
